by

Where communities thrive


  • Join over 1.5M+ people
  • Join over 100K+ communities
  • Free without limits
  • Create your own community
People
Repo info
Activity
    Arnaud Esteve
    @aesteve
    Unfortunately, you are not allowed to access the page you've requested. It seems you don't have sufficient permissions.
    Pavel Fatin
    @pavelfatin
    Arnaud Esteve
    @aesteve
    Thx, an umbrella issue for every keyword, or rather a single issue per keyword ?
    Pavel Fatin
    @pavelfatin
    It's probably better to create a separate ticket for each keyword.
    Arnaud Esteve
    @aesteve
    ok, I'll do that, then
    Arnaud Esteve
    @aesteve
    https://youtrack.jetbrains.com/issue/SCL-17230 just tell me if anything is missing, I'll update the ticket, thanks a lot for the plugin update!
    Pavel Fatin
    @pavelfatin
    Looks good, thanks!
    nafg
    @nafg
    @aesteve I'm not sure if it's what you meant to to ask, but EAP doesn't force you to use scala 3, I've been using EAP for a while already for scala 2
    Arnaud Esteve
    @aesteve
    Oh no, that's not what I meant, sorry if I've been unclear. That's just : in order to test Scala 3 I needed to install EAP, and when I installed EAP, it told me a lot of plugins wouldn't be active anylonger. But thanks to the good tip about Jetbrains platform, I've managed to install it separately, so I'm perfectly fine :)
    thanks for your comment :)
    Mikhail Mutcianko
    @mutcianm
    @superseacat good news: you actually can pull IJ plugins using maven API: https://plugins.jetbrains.com/docs/marketplace/maven-interface.html
    Wojtek Pituła
    @Krever
    Im trying to use ammonite support in IntelliJ and it doesnt work, unfortunately. When I try to import dependencies via popup it does nothign...
    Pablo Pérez García
    @politrons
    Hi all, I just install the EAP version to play with dotty and run test by sbt work just fine.But code it does not compile in the IDE
    any idea how to make it compile to being able to play a little bit with
    Artem Egorkine
    @arteme
    Is there any macro errors support (thrown when macro calls c.abort) or work towards that? I'm working with macwire and it would be nice to get highlighting for incorrect wire-macro usage
    Paolo G. Giarrusso
    @Blaisorblade
    @politrons probably you should ignore the intellij errors as false positives — maybe you can still disable them altogether?
    (is IntelliJ for Dotty still using its own presentation compiler?)
    any plan to use the real presentation compiler, either directly or through Dotty’s future version of Metals?
    Justin Kaeser
    @jastice
    @Blaisorblade for compiler messages we don't use presentation compiler for Dotty, but the actual Scala compiler (or BSP server in such BSP projects)
    Nikolay Tropin
    @niktrop
    @arteme For now, the only option is to reimplement these errors in Scala plugin. For example, you may write a custom inspection: https://github.com/JetBrains/intellij-scala/wiki/Library-Extensions
    @politrons Compilation should work after sbt project import. If you opened your project in IDEA 2019.3 or before, you may need to remove .idea folder first.
    Wojtek Pituła
    @Krever

    Hey, I configured sbt with

    sourceDirectories := Seq(file("."))

    (I'm trying to have minimal dir structure/project size)
    yet its not recognized by intellij after import - root is not marked as source root

    Dmitrii Naumenko
    @unkarjedy
    @Krever Could you please create a ticket about Ammonite?
    Wojtek Pituła
    @Krever
    I will try but I already removed my project
    Tomasz Pasternak
    @tpasternak
    how to find out which commit was used for nightly build?
    Pavel Fatin
    @pavelfatin

    @politrons

    But code it does not compile in the IDE any idea how to make it compile to being able to play a little bit with

    If this means that there are errors in editor, please see https://gitter.im/JetBrains/intellij-scala?at=5e72001db00d7a3a2cc571e2

    NB: to try Scala 3, please use Nightly builds, not EAP builds
    kerr
    @hepin1989
    image.png
    Stop a long time when try to add type annotation to akka project
    After long time UI freeze, it's indexing now
    Nikolay Tropin
    @niktrop
    @hepin1989 Please report such problems to https://youtrack.jetbrains.com/newIssue?SCL
    Nikolay Tropin
    @niktrop
    @tpasternak We don't add git tags for nightly builds, usually it is the last build of idea201.x branch available on 12:00 AM GMT.
    kerr
    @hepin1989
    @niktrop okay
    vinhhv
    @vinhhv
    hi all, im having trouble getting intellij to recognize code generated by macros. im running intellij 2019.3.4, sbt 1.3.8 and scala 2.13.1 (which comes with scala-macros-paradise). any ideas what i could do fix this?
    Wojtek Pituła
    @Krever
    I think intellij is not using neither sourceDirectory nor sourceDirectories sbt settings when importing modules. Is it a known limitation or a bug?
    Effect: patch configures under those settings in build.sbt are not marked as sources roots in intellij project structure.
    superseacat
    @superseacat
    is it a vary bad practice to post here links to JB's forum (but the description is rather long there): https://intellij-support.jetbrains.com/hc/en-us/community/posts/360007731119-Issues-configuring-a-dependency-for-a-3-rd-party-plugin-Scala- ?
    Nikolay Tropin
    @niktrop
    @superseacat It's ok, if your question is related to scala plugin. It seems that you've already got a response there.
    superseacat
    @superseacat
    @niktrop thanks!
    objektwerks
    @objektwerks
    FYI: "de.heikoseeberger" %% "akka-http-upickle" % "1.31.0" is causing Intellij Akka-Http code to code massively red. Dropping back to version 1.30.0 will remove all of the Intellij red errors. I'm using all of the latest versions of Akka, Akka-Http and UPickle. Outside of Intellij, version 1.3.1 works just fine. Not sure what's going.
    Dale Wijnand
    @dwijnand
    Is anyone on the intellij-scala team (or anyoen in general) opening the dotty project in IJ? I'm having trouble with it.
    Pavel Fatin
    @pavelfatin
    We plan to make sure that it works, but we haven't looked into that yet :) What's the problem exactly?
    Dale Wijnand
    @dwijnand
    Actually just got it working, https://github.com/lampepfl/dotty/pull/8586/files fixed it.
    Pavel Fatin
    @pavelfatin
    Wow... Good to know, thanks!
    Justin Kaeser
    @jastice
    @Krever it uses unmanagedSourceDirectories
    Benjamin Nash
    @benash
    Hi, is anyone using the sbt-dotenv plugin? It seems to work correctly when running through the sbt shell for me, but not when running with ctrl+shift+R. (2019.3.4 CE)
    kerr
    @hepin1989
    image.png
    It would be better to create the java folder when first init a project?
    superseacat
    @superseacat
    hey,
    GH Scala Plugin repository describes itself as "scalaCommunity" and has some nice REPL functionality: https://github.com/JetBrains/intellij-scala/tree/b0d3ce8285a7f938ce15e5edc4818a209e8effa8/scala/scala-impl/src/org/jetbrains/plugins/scala/console . Is there a chance, that somewhere out there there are tests exist for REPL console functionality?
    Dmitrii Naumenko
    @unkarjedy
    @superseacat
    No, unfortunately, we do not have any tests for REPL console for now
    superseacat
    @superseacat
    @unkarjedy sad, as I coud spy there some something)